Job Summary

Lead the global strategy operations and expansion of AWS Skills Centers worldwide driving AWSs mission to build a pipeline of future AI and Cloud builders. AWS Skills Centers are free in-person training locations operated by AWS Training & Certification offering fundamental cloud education and AI training to the public in fixed locations. These centers specifically target new-to-tech learners career-changers students and community organizations making cloud and AI education accessible to all. Through classroom instruction and interactive experiences Skills Centers guide learners toward industry certifications continued learning through AWS and connections with the broader cloud community to support their career development journey. This role provides strategic vision and executive leadership for existing Skills Centers while developing frameworks for partner-sponsored expansion ensuring consistency in quality experience and outcomes across all locations.

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$160300/year in our lowest geographic market up to $265000/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ge skills and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ered equity sign-on payments and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package in addition to a full range of medical financial and/or other benefits.
